The Blueprint of Calmness

Before we jump into the thick of it, let’s make sure you’re equipped with the basics. For this craft, you’ll need nothing more than a sheet of paper—any kind will do, but a bit of sturdiness goes a long way—a pen or pencil, and a dash of creativity. That’s it! Who would’ve thunk that such mundane items could be your allies in the battle against anxiety?

Step-by-Step Guide: Crafting Your Anxiety Ally

  1. Foundation of Serenity: Begin by laying your sheet of paper flat. Fold it in half diagonally, corner to corner, to create a triangle. Unfold it, and then fold it in the opposite diagonal direction. This crisscross pattern will serve as the backbone of your game.

  2. The Origami Hatch: Next, fold each corner of the paper towards the center, meeting at the midpoint where your folds intersect. You’ll end up with a smaller square whose corners are brimming with potential.

  3. Inscribe Your Worries and Wonders: On each of the four outer squares, scribble down what triggers your anxiety. Be honest; this game is a private affair, after all. Flip the paper over, and in the newly exposed squares, write activities or thoughts that bring you joy or relaxation.

  4. A Peek Into the Future: Lift each flap and inscribe a positive affirmation or a coping mechanism underneath. These hidden messages are your secret weapons, ready to be unveiled when anxiety strikes.

  5. The Final Origami Dance: Now, fold the square in half, then fold it once more, giving you a smaller square that fits snugly in your palms. Gently pull the flaps under and tuck them in to create a flexible moving game.

  6. Game On! To play, maneuver the origami with your fingers, opening and closing the flaps as you recite your worries and unveil the counteracting joys and coping strategies hidden within.

Why It Works: The Science Behind the Paper

Wondering how something as simple as paper and words can be a staunch ally against anxiety? The magic lies in the act of engagement and expression. By externalizing your anxieties and coping strategies onto paper, you’re not only acknowledging their existence but also taking proactive steps to address them. This tangible representation enables a moment of mindfulness, allowing you to confront your feelings in a controlled and safe environment.

Moreover, the dual nature of the game—pairing anxieties with positive counterpoints—anchors the concept that for every negative thought, a positive spin or coping mechanism can be employed. It’s a hands-on reminder that balance exists, and with the right tools, calmness can be restored.
